I wouldn’t remove the whole baffle as it would likely sound awful. I put some take off heritage style mufflers on my 23 Softail Standard and removed the restrictor plate inside the muffler. Just a 1 1/4” hole saw and about 2 minutes. A little deeper idle but a louder growl on acceleration. They may work for you. On my old sporty I had them and can’t say they changed anything. Trikes and Touring bike have the cat in the header vs in the mufflers like the softails/sportys so you may notice a little difference since you have the back pressure of the Cat still. Just a guess though.

If you remove baffles you’ll want to tune accordingly. I’d stick with what I’ve seen in the thread and recommend going with some kind of other muffler system or a 2-into-1 with back pressure. M8s like it to keep your tq and power up.
